Кабинет тимлида разработки: как управлять задачами и код‑ревью
Тимлид — это человек, который отвечает и за код, и за людей. Ему нужно видеть загрузку разработчиков, контролировать выполнение задач, проводить код-ревью, следить за качеством. Хаотичные задачи в Jira и разбросанные pull request'ы в GitHub — не всегда удобно. Можно всё объединить в одном кабинете тимлида. Расскажу, какую информацию вывести на дашборд, чтобы тимлид был в курсе всего.
Что тимлид хочет видеть ежедневно
- Список задач команды с приоритетами, статусами, оценками в часах.
- Загрузку разработчиков (сколько задач в работе у каждого, оценочное время).
- Задачи, у которых приближается дедлайн.
- Задачи на код-ревью (ссылки на пул-реквесты, статус проверки).
- Количество багов в продакшене и в тестировании.
- Метрики качества кода (если есть интеграция с SonarQube или подобными).
Как организовать единое окно
Если у вас уже есть система задач (например, YouTrack, Jira), можно выгружать данные через API и показывать в кабинете. Если нет — используйте свою таблицу «Задачи» с полями: проект, исполнитель, оценка, статус, дата дедлайна. Добавьте таблицу «Пул-реквесты» (ссылка на GitHub/GitLab, автор, статус ревью).
Для интеграции с Git можно написать скрипт, который раз в час забирает открытые PR и сохраняет в базу. Тимлид видит их в своём кабинете и может менять статус ревью.
Пример: как тимлид в продуктовой компании сократил время код-ревью вдвое
Было: разработчики присылали ссылки на PR в общий чат, тимлид терялся. Внедрили кабинет, где отображаются все ожидающие ревью задачи с сортировкой по приоритету проекта. Тимлид выделяет 30 минут утром и час после обеда на ревью — всё под контролем. Среднее время от создания PR до закрытия сократилось с 2 дней до 1 дня.
Метрики для руководителя команды
Полезно добавить отчёты: сколько задач закрыто каждым разработчиком за спринт, какое перевыполнение или недовыполнение плана. Это поможет в мотивации и планировании.
Также можно интегрировать кабинет тимлида с чатом (Telegram или Slack) для получения уведомлений о критических багах.
Личный кабинет тимлида — это про контроль без микроменеджмента. Вы даёте тимлиду прозрачность, а он сам управляет процессом. Falcon Space позволяет собрать все эти данные в одном месте, подключив к существующим API или используя собственную базу. Настройка займёт несколько дней, а эффективность повысится сразу.
Смотрите также:
Дилерский кабинет: индивидуальные цены и остатки для опта
Агентский кабинет: планы продаж, комиссия, отчёты для выездных менеджеров
Кабинет курьера: маршруты, фотофиксация, подписи клиентов
Кабинет менеджера: история заказов, переписка, быстрые действия
Кабинет бухгалтера: отчёты, сверка с 1С, контроль дебиторки
Кабинет руководителя: дашборд по воронке, нагрузка сотрудников
Партнёрский кабинет: передача лидов, совместные проекты, выплаты
Кабинет заказчика: проекты, этапы, оплата, рейтинг исполнителей
- Шаг 1. Создать концепт проекта
- Шаг 2. Получить оценку бюджета (КП)
- Шаг 3. Заключить договор
- Шаг 4. Создать совместно техническое задание
- Шаг 5. Поэтапная реализация проекта